Georgia Currency
A Pleasing “Man Holding A Cane” Eight Dollar Note
(1776) Undated, $8, “Man Holding Cane” vignette, Extremely Fine.
An impressive looking note and of a highly distinctive design and vignette. Printed in both red and black having three full margins, the top border being slightly irregular and partially touching into the outer border design. One pinhole, otherwise nice and clean with strong red and black printing and a sharply detailed vignette, having the words “EIGHT & DOLLARS” in bold red above and below. Five exceptional dark rich brown ink signatures, the serial number having been written in the same hand as that of the Newman plate note for this issue.
